Toscotec starts up a turnkey tissue plant for Intertrade Hellas in Greece

Toscotec is pleased to announce the start-up of the turnkey project featuring AHEAD 2.2L for Intertrade Hellas at its Oinofyta paper mill, near Athens. Drawing on decades of engineering experience, Toscotec continues to support the customer by providing innovative solutions that offer unmatched production flexibility and a constant step forward in operational excellence. The machine features a net sheet width of 5,600 mm, a maximum operating speed of 2,200 m/min, and a production capacity of up to 80,000 tons/year, over a range of Facial, Toilet, Napkin and Towel products.

SCA to increase kraftliner prices by € 100 per tonne

SCA will increase the prices on all Kraftliner grades in Europe by € 100 per tonne. The new price is valid from April 1, 2026.

SCA aims for 40 percent lower emissions from RoRo vessels

Starting on 1 October 2026, SCA will implement changes to its sea transport using RoRo vessels (Roll-on/Roll-off) by reducing speed, increasing vessel load factors, and adjusting how the ports in Umeå and Piteå are used. One effect of these changes is that emissions from the vessels will be reduced by approximately 40 percent.

Sappi Europe announces price increase for Fusion Top Liner effective April 2026

Corrugators and printers serving leading brands with high-performance packaging and displays rely on the consistent availability of premium coated and uncoated liner board. In recent years extensive internal cost and efficiency initiatives, including organisational restructuring and operational optimisation were implemented. Despite these actions, continued price erosion has created a widening gap between structural costs and the pricing levels required to maintain a sustainable and reliable supply. To address this imbalance, Sappi Europe will implement a price increase of 7% to 8% on coated and uncoated premier Fusion Liner board, effective 1 April 2026.

Kemira announces price increase for AKD wax

Kemira will implement a price increase of 10-20% for all AKD (alkyl ketene dimer) wax products, effective immediately or as contracts permit. The adjustment is driven by significantly higher costs across the AKD wax value chain.
